Sorry for delay in reply...
You get infos using:
Everest, Sandra, CPU-Z (Windows)
Some infos get using System Profiler (OSX)
Manufacturer site and manuals are good too

Just installed it, haven't messed around with it much, but the install went extremely smoothly. Took like 15 minutes for the actual install. Only issue I had was with the dual boot on the same HD as Vista - got a HFS+ error on the disk after the install, but fixed it easily. Now I can dual boot Vista and OS X no problem.

Everything works fine except the video issues. Radeon X800XT Platinum AGP 256MB RAM. So far I have not been able to get QE to work. CI works with Callisto 008 and patched radeon9700GA plugin, with APGART 2.4.6. Video RAM is detected as 128 instead of 256.
USB and Firewire work 100%. Firewire sound works 100%. Nothing in the PCI slots is recognised by profiler, but the Belkin PCI network card works, and the 1394 port on the Audigy 2 card works. Wireless USB keyboard and Microsoft Optical Mouse work 100%. USB 1.1 and 2.0 are both 100% and recognise all devices.
The About screen identifies the correct amout of RAM but the profiler only lists slot 1.
All EIDE and SATA drives are recognised and disk burning works fine.
